Teenage Tibetan girl self-immolates |
12 February 2012
Tenzin Choedon (right), an 18-year-old, has become the latest Tibetan to set themselves on fire.
Tenzin, a nun from Dechen Chokorling Nunnery (also known as Mamae Nunnery), Ngaba Town, has died.
Tibetan protest
Tenzin was calling out slogans of protest against the Chinese government when she self-immolated.
Soldiers and police came immediately and took her away. Soldiers then surrounded the site and sealed it off. Nothing more is known of the situation there.
China's war
Tenzin is the second nun from this nunnery to self-immolate. Last year 20-year-old Tenzin Wangmo died after setting herself on fire.
The latest self-immolation took place just days after the Chinese leader of the Tibet Autonomous Region told Communist Party members to prepare for “a war against secessionist sabotage”.
